[2-21]= Refrigerant recovery/vacuuming mode
In order to achieve a free pathway to reclaim refrigerant out
of the system or to remove residual substances or to vacu-
um the system it is necessary to apply a setting which will
open required valves in the refrigerant circuit so the reclaim
of refrigerant or vacuuming process can be done properly.
Default value=0.
To activate function change [2-21]=1.
To stop the refrigerant recovery/vacuuming mode, push
BS3. If BS3 is not pushed, the system will remain in refriger-
ant recovery/vacuuming mode.
[2-22]= Automatic low noise setting and level during night time
By changing this setting, you activate the automatic low
noise operation function of the unit and define the level of
operation. Depending on the chosen level, the noise level
will be lowered (3: Level 3<2: Level2<1: Level1).
The start and stop moments for this function are defined
under setting [2-26] and [2-27].
Default value=0.
To activate function change [2-22]=1, 2 or 3.
[2-25]= Low noise operation level via the external control adaptor
If the system needs to be running under low noise operation
conditions when an external signal is sent to the unit, this
setting defines the level of low noise that will be applied (3:
Level 3<2: Level 2<1: Level 1).
This setting will only be effective when the optional external
control adaptor (DTA104A61/62) is installed and the setting
[2-12] was activated.
Default value=2.
To activate function change [2-25]=1, 2 or 3.

[2-32]= Forced, all time, power consumption limitation operation
(no external control adaptor is required to perform power
consumption limitation)
If the system always needs to be running under power
consumption limitation conditions, this setting activates and
defines the level power consumption limitation that will be
applied continuously. The level is according to the table.
Default value=0 (OFF).
